About This Course

PTSD in late life can result from trauma that occurred much earlier or can follow traumatic events that occurred for the first time in old age. This training will approach treatment of PTSD in older adults from a trauma informed lens, and discuss considerations in working with older adults and trauma. Case studies and treatment tools will be offered to deepen understanding of concepts and interventions. Participants will have the opportunity to assess their own professional quality of life in the context of trauma stewardship

Participants will be able to...

  • Define Trauma Informed Care principles and their application to PTSD treatment.
  • Identify considerations in working with trauma in older adults.
  • Explore methods of psychoeducation and treatment orientation.
  • Consider treatment tools, such as WOT, NET, and CBT.Ā 
  • Assess one’s own trauma stewardship and Professional Quality of Life.
